Where does “ܬܘܢܘܣ” come from?

ܬܘܢܘܣ (Classical Syriac) comes from Ancient Greek θύννος, from Ancient Greek θύνω — to rush along.

ܬܘܢܘܣ (Classical Syriac): tuna, tunny
